My Business

my business in particular is chicken rearing, where by I take care of small chicks until they grow up to layers or broilers then I sell them at a higher price, I also keep the layers from which I sell eggs every week, I ask get income from my salary,I am an employed teacher who go to work from 8am to 4 am after which I go to my business

Loan Proposal

I want to do small scale farming where by I want to plant cabbage seedlings. I will hire a quarter an acre land then I will buy all the materials needed for planting cabbages
